Known for its diverse landscapes, Karnataka is home to several vital water reservoirs that play an important role in sustaining agriculture, providing drinking water, and contributing to overall economic growth. Gayathri Reservoir, nestled in the Hiriyur taluk of Chitradurga, is among the smaller water reservoirs in the area, but the sight of its waters spilling over in times of abundance still draws crowds of spectators. The reservoir was constructed across the Suvarnamukhi River in 1963 and is surrounded by hills and greenery. The shimmering blue waters held within create a serene ambiance, offering a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of urban life.
